Undergraduate Tuition & Fees

The following table compares 2023-2024 undergraduate tuition & fees between selected colleges. The average undergraduate tuition & fees is $26,092 for all students. The 2023-2024 undergraduate tuition & fees of selected colleges are increased by 4.63% compared to the previous year.
Among the selected colleges, Hampden-Sydney College requires the most expensive tuition & fees of $52,388 and Riverside College of Health Careers has the lowest tuition & fees of $14,875 for undergraduate programs.
Undergraduate Tuition & Fess Comparison Between Selected Colleges
Name2022-20232023-2024
In-StateOut-of-StateIn-StateOut-of-State
Bryant & Stratton College-Hampton $18,587$18,827
Hampden-Sydney College $50,740$52,388
University of Lynchburg $34,500$35,540
Riverside College of Health Careers $12,380$14,875
Southern Virginia University $19,108$20,040
Virginia Union University $14,305$14,880
Average$24,937$26,092
